WebJul 21, 2024 · SA's (acronym for Solutions Architect) participate of discovery. These are the early stages of conversation with a client, where many questions are asked. An SA needs to understand everything about their client, their product or project, their goals, their problems, so they can map those to tangible solution suggestions. WebJan 5, 2024 · A business architect is NOT an enterprise architect. However, because business architecture is an integral part of enterprise architecture, there are many commonalities and overlaps – at least as far as the business domain definition and strategy interpretation. A business architect is NOT a solution architect.

WebFeb 26, 2024 · A solutions architect usually acts as an intermediary between the technical and non-technical project stakeholders and finds means to meet all of their requirements during the application development process. Explaining technical details to the management team, informing the stakeholders about the development progress, costs, and timeline is ...

This includes cloud adoption plans, cloud application design, and cloud management and monitoring.
